Roof Repair
Most Kyle roof repairs run $400 to $1,800 depending on what’s compromised and how far the damage has spread. A small leak around a vent boot or pipe flashing is usually under $700 when we catch it early. The problem in Kyle is that “early” is hard. Production builders put a lot of roofs up fast after 2005, and we regularly find nail pops, improper flashing, and wind-lifted shingles on homes in Kyle subdivisions that look spotless from the street. If you see granules in the gutter or a shingle in the yard after a storm, call before a small repair becomes a sheathing replacement.

Metal Roofing
Metal roof installation in Kyle runs $15,000 to $40,000, and the wide spread comes down to material choice. Standing seam systems are a serious investment that handles Kyle’s hail and 100-degree summers exceptionally well, but they’re not the same price as screw-down agricultural panels. Homeowners in 6 Creeks who plan to stay put for 20-plus years lean toward standing seam for the longevity and the insurance perks. We’ll walk you through the difference line by line, in writing.

Tile Roofing
Kyle has a smaller tile roof population than Austin’s west side, but the homes that have tile tend to be the custom builds scattered around the eastern edge of the city near the Blackland Prairie. Tile roof repair here runs $600 to $2,500 for broken or displaced tiles, replacement underlayment segments, and re-bedding ridge caps. Tile hides trouble well, and a hairline crack you can’t see from the ground is exactly how a dry rot problem starts. We inspect the whole roof, not just the spot that’s visibly broken.

Common Roofing Problems We See in Kyle Homes
- Wind-lifted shingles after spring thunderstorms. Kyle gets hit with sudden, violent downbursts that peel shingles off production-builder roofs where fast installation skipped enough sealant or nails. What looks like one missing shingle is often a dozen ready to go.
- Pipe boot and flashing failures on Young Homes. The vast majority of Kyle’s housing stock went up after 2005 using similar templates and materials across entire neighborhoods. When a flashing detail fails at year nine on one house in Plum Creek, we usually see the same failure on three more within the same block within the same season.
- Thermal fatigue on south-facing slopes. Kyle’s 100-degree-plus summer days beat on south-facing shingle surfaces relentlessly. Granule loss and curling show up years earlier than homeowners expect, especially when attic ventilation was cut to the builder minimum.
- Hail impact from fast-moving cells. Kyle sits in the hail corridor that runs along I-35, and roofs that look fine from the curb can have thousands of micro-fractures after a single hailstorm. Insurance adjusters miss it routinely. We document what we find so you have what you need to file or re-open a claim.
Pricing for Roofing in Kyle, TX
Roof repair in Kyle runs $400 to $1,800 for most common issues. Roof replacement runs $8,000 to $20,000 depending on size, pitch, and material grade. Metal roof installation on a standard single-family home sits between $15,000 and $40,000, and tile repair lands between $600 and $2,500. What changes the number most is how long the underlying issue has been allowed to progress. A leak caught in week one is a $450 repair. The same leak discovered six months later when the decking rots becomes a multi-thousand-dollar section replacement.
